www.rpmsfa.com的IP地址是:20.157.114.78 数字IP:345862734
ASN归属地 :美国Microsoft数据中心 United States Falls Church
IPV4地址 | 20.157.114.78 |
数字IP地址 | 345862734 |
IPV6地址 | 0000:0000:0000:0000:0000:ffff:149d:724e |
映射IPv6地址 | ::ffff:149d:724e |
兼容IPv6地址 | ::149d:724e |
兼容IPV4的IPV6地址 | 0:0:0:0:0:0:20.157.114.78 |
::20.157.114.78 |
20.157.114.78 2024-12-31----2025-01-03
148.66.243.89 2022-08-24----2024-03-22
12.3.100.212 2020-05-20----2021-04-21
www.rpmsfa.com 2024-12-31----2025-01-03